From NUTL Khartoum Office, Nationwide participated actively in what has been considered the largest major transformation of the road transport sector in Khartoum. Contesting alongside 10 other large multinationals and companies from several parts of the world, Nationwide's highly affordable pricing, quality buses, managerial expertise, experience and attractive payment terms won the highly competitive bid to supply 6,720 luxurious buses for interstate and intra-city transport within Sudan. Valued at over US$1.5billion, the contract is currently being executed by Nationwide unity Transport Limited.
